CVE-2019-25722

The CVE-2019-25722 entry concerns Dräger SC Monitoring devices (SC 6002XL, SC 6802XL, SC 7000, SC 8000, SC 9000 XL). Affected component: source code contains hard-coded plaintext credentials that can be used by a local attacker to access service and clinical accounts; a remote attacker can send m...

CVE-2026-42251

The CVE concerns KS-SOMED where hard-coded credentials in KSPLUPDFTP.exe (up to 30.00.00.056) and ANEKSKLIENT.EXE (up to 29.00.02.026) allowed an unauthorized actor to access an FTP server hosting update packages. This could enable uploading a malicious update that might be distributed and instal...
